Ah, interesting. In Trinidad we have a common base class for
components that iterate over a collection:
http://myfaces.apache.org/trinidad/trinidad-api/apidocs/org/apache/myface...
This is used as the base for both UIXIterator (Trinidad equivalent of
ui:repeat) and UIXTable (Trinidad equivalent for UIData). Perhaps for
2.1 we should consider surfacing a similar base class/contract, along
with a public UIRepeat component.
RichFaces uses the same approach too. I believe
that iteration
components should be complete rewritten in JSF 2.1 using such
architecture. Does Trinidad tree comonent use the same base class ?
